Importance of Selecting a Baby Name:

Choosing a baby name is a momentous decision for parents, as it holds significance in various aspects of a child's life. Here's why it's important:

Identity: A name is a crucial part of a person's identity and self-esteem.

Cultural Connection: It can connect a child to their cultural and familial roots.

Meaningful Significance: Names often have meanings that reflect qualities, aspirations, or values parents wish for their children.

Impact on Life: A name can influence how a child is perceived, affecting their social and professional life.

Uniqueness: Parents want their child's name to stand out while being easy to pronounce and remember.

Personal Expression: It's an opportunity for parents to express their creativity and individuality.
